Scavenger Hunt!

A familiar toy. A little hiding place. A new discovery together.

2 yearsFamiliar toys or household objects
A toy and cloth tucked into a wicker discovery basket

Start with a little play.

  1. Choose a few familiar things.

    Gather toys or everyday objects your child knows. Show each one before the game begins.

  2. Hide them in easy places.

    Let your child watch you hide the objects. Keep part of an object visible if that makes the search easier.

  3. Look, notice, and try again.

    Invite your child to find the objects. Offer a clue when needed, then take another turn together.

Something you could say

Could it be under the cushion?

Make the game your own

A discovery worth repeating.

Try one easy hiding place first. You can keep the same objects and change where you put them when your child is ready for another round.

  • Leave part of the toy showing
  • Offer a simple clue
  • Let your child choose the next hiding place
